What is the best way to integrate all the stages in Spiral Dynamics? Namely, Tier 1 stages. Could it generally be categorized like this? Beige - Health and Nutrition (meditation, diet etc) Purple - Friends and (functional + non-toxic) Family Red - Assertiveness Blue - Discipline, Values, Purpose Orange - Success and Financial stability Green - Compassion for everyone and everything Yellow - Radical openmindedness, Systems thinking, Grey thinking (not black and white)
